Experience the rewarding impact of supporting students’ communication growth as a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) or Clinical Fellow (CFY) in a thriving educational setting. This full-time, contract opportunity offers 37.5 hours per week, serving a diverse age group from kindergarten through 22 years. You'll play a meaningful role in helping students overcome a variety of communication and language barriers, particularly those with moderate to severe disabilities.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Deliver direct speech-language therapy for students aged 2 to 22, adapting strategies to individual and diverse needs.
  • Address areas including assistive technology, augmentative communication, social language skills, articulation, voice, oral-motor skills, feeding, and receptive/expressive language delays.
  • Complete diagnostic and evaluative assessments, producing clear, actionable reports based on findings and classroom observations.
  • Develop and maintain measurable IEP objectives, closely tracking student progress towards goals.
  • Collaborate seamlessly with parents, special education teams, and colleagues, fostering open communication about students’ developmental milestones and challenges.
  • Utilize flexibility and creative problem-solving to adapt to changing needs and classroom dynamics.

Qualifications:

  • Must possess, or be eligible for, a Delaware state SLP license.
  • SLP-CCC, SLP-CFY, or relevant experience working with students with moderate to severe disabilities highly valued.
  • Strong interpersonal and communication skills are essential, as is a team-oriented mindset.
  • Ability to adapt and troubleshoot in a dynamic school environment.
